Installation / Application:
Difficulty: 2/5
Estimated time: 30-60 minutes
Suggested Tools:
Trim removal tool or flat plastic pry
Phillips and flathead screwdrivers
Clean cloths and isopropyl alcohol
Masking tape
Replacement trim clips or retainers (if needed)
Rubber mallet (optional)
Instructions:
Park vehicle on a level surface and lower windows (if applicable) to access beltline area.
Carefully remove the old molding using a trim removal tool or pry bar, taking care not to damage the paint or glass. Remove any old clips or fasteners.
Clean the mounting channel thoroughly with isopropyl alcohol and a clean cloth to remove dirt, adhesive residue, and corrosion.
Dry-fit each new molding piece to verify orientation (inner vs. outer, left vs. right) and alignment before final installation.
Install any required retainers or replacement clips into the mounting channel or onto the molding per vehicle-specific layout.
Align the molding with the channel and press firmly along its length to engage clips or use light taps with a rubber mallet where needed. Ensure ends meet and gaps are even.
Reinstall any adjacent trim or weatherstripping removed during disassembly and verify window operation and sealing.
Wipe the new chrome finish with a soft cloth to remove fingerprints and inspect the installation for secure fit and consistent fitment.
